The meeting included mayoral comments regarding the recent Trenton Business Trick or Treat event and a staff announcement that the Chief of Police applied for a grant for new bulletproof vests. Under Unfinished Business, the minutes of the October 13, 2025 Regular Council Meeting were approved, and the Parks & Recreation Coordinator position was approved, appointing Megan Donjon for a one-year contract. New Business addressed Ordinance #1877 granting special use at 170 N Oak, which includes the commitment to stripe diagonal parking lanes in the spring. The council also approved the hiring of two patrol officers, Tyler Griesbaum and Danielle Helbig, pending successful completion of required testing and training. The City Attorney will draft language for reviewing paid holidays and personal days for officers upon hire, potentially replacing the 90-day waiting period. Furthermore, the council discussed the Tax Increment Finance (TIF) assistance application from FRV Properties for their business relocation and propane storage consolidation, with preliminary agreement on a reimbursement package structure to be formalized later.
